Wisdom produces substantive blessing, while fools only multiply their own folly.
In Proverbs 14:24, Solomon says, The crown of the wise is their riches, but the folly of fools is foolishness (v. 24). Wisdom produces wealth of some kind, and that abundance becomes like a crown.
The riches of the wise may include material provision, but also the broader wealth of understanding, stability, and fruitfulness. Wisdom tends to add substantive blessing to life. That blessing is called a crown because it visibly honors the one who walks wisely.
But the folly of fools is foolishness. Fools do not transform their condition into something better. What they produce is merely more of the same. Their path compounds folly rather than converting it into gain. This is the tragic stagnation of foolish living.
